Ingredients Needed
To make Dolly Parton’s Cabbage Soup Diet Recipe, you’ll need a range of fresh, whole foods that are packed with vitamins, fiber, and flavor. Here’s a breakdown of what you’ll need:
- 1 medium head of cabbage: The star of the soup, cabbage is low in calories and high in fiber, which makes it a key player in the weight-loss game.
- 1 large onion: Adds depth to the soup’s flavor and also has natural diuretic properties that help in detoxifying the body.
- 1 green bell pepper: Provides a touch of sweetness and is rich in antioxidants like vitamin C.
- 2-3 celery stalks: These are essential for adding crunch and flavor, while also helping with digestion due to their high water content.
- 2 tomatoes: Tomatoes bring acidity and brightness, along with being an excellent source of lycopene, an antioxidant.
- 4 cloves garlic: Known for its antibacterial and immune-boosting properties, garlic adds a savory depth to the soup.
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ano: Adds an earthy, herbaceous flavor, perfect for complementing the cabbage and other vegetables.
- 1 teaspoon dried basil: Provides a mild, sweet taste that balances out the acidity of the tomatoes.
- Salt and pepper: Essential for seasoning and enhancing the natural flavors of the ingredients.
- Vegetable broth: A light, flavorful liquid base that helps the vegetables cook down and meld together, creating a rich, savory soup.
Cooking Instructions
Making Dolly Parton’s cabbage soup is easy and quick. Here’s how to do it step by step:
-
Prepare The Vegetables
- Start by chopping the cabbage into thin strips, the onion into small chunks, and the bell pepper and celery into bite-sized pieces. Mince the garlic and dice the tomatoes.
-
Sauté The Aromatics
- In a large pot, heat a tablespoon of olive oil over medium heat. Add the onions, bell pepper, and garlic. Sauté for about 5 minutes, or until the vegetables start to soften and release their flavors.
-
Add The Tomatoes And Seasonings
- Stir in the tomatoes, dried oregano, and basil. Let the tomatoes cook down for a few minutes, until they release their juices and become soft.
-
Simmer The Soup
- Add the cabbage, celery, and vegetable broth to the pot. Stir well to combine everything. Bring the mixture to a simmer and let it cook for about 30 minutes, stirring occasionally. The cabbage should be tender, and the flavors should be fully melded.
-
Adjust Seasoning
- Once the soup is done, taste it and adjust the seasoning with salt and pepper to your liking. You can also add a dash of red pepper flakes if you prefer a little heat.
-
Serve And Enjoy
- Ladle the soup into bowls and serve hot. It’s perfect for a light, filling meal that can be enjoyed throughout the day.

Expert Tips
Want to take your cabbage soup to the next level? Here are some expert tips to make sure it’s as tasty and effective as possible:
- Use fresh ingredients: Fresh vegetables will bring more flavor and nutrients to your soup compared to frozen or canned alternatives.
- Don’t skip the herbs: The dried oregano and basil are non-negotiable-they’ll transform your soup from bland to flavorful with minimal effort.
- Let the soup sit overnight: For even better flavor, allow the soup to cool, refrigerate it overnight, and then reheat it the next day. The flavors will have more time to develop.
- Bulk up the veggies: If you’re looking for a heartier soup, feel free to add more vegetables like zucchini, carrots, or spinach. The more variety, the more nutrients you’ll pack into each serving.
- Adjust the broth: If you’re not a fan of vegetable broth, chicken broth can be substituted for a richer flavor.
Recipe Variations
While Dolly Parton’s version of the cabbage soup diet is delicious as is, you can easily make some variations to suit your taste preferences or dietary needs. Here are a few ideas:
- Spicy Cabbage Soup: Add a diced jalapeño or some hot sauce to give the soup a fiery kick.
- Meat Lovers’ Version: Brown some ground turkey or chicken before adding the vegetables for a protein-packed twist.
- Low-Sodium Option: Use low-sodium vegetable broth and skip adding extra salt to keep the sodium content low.
- Vegan/Vegetarian: This recipe is already plant-based, but you can swap in vegetable broth for chicken broth to keep it vegan-friendly.
